About Mircera 50mcg Injection

Mircera 50mcg Injection is used to treat anemia in people with chronic kidney disease (long-term serious kidney disease). It works by stimulating the stem cells of the bone marrow to increase red blood cells production. This way it helps to reverse anemia.Mircera 50mcg Injection is generally given by a doctor or a nurse. Do not self-administer this medicine at home. The dose depends on your body weight and the severity of your condition. Get the injection regularly until you completed the dose. Iron supplements both before and during treatment may make this treatment more effective.Use of this medicine may cause some common side effects such as headache, diarrhea, body aches, and vomiting. These side effects persist or get worse, let your doctor know. They may be able to suggest ways to prevent or treat them.Before using the medicine, tell your doctor if you have uncontrolled high blood pressure, heart disease, or gout (disease of joint pain). You should also tell him/her what other medicines you are taking in case they affect this treatment. Your blood pressure should be checked often during this treatment by you or your doctor. You may also need other regular medical tests to be sure this medicine is not causing harmful effects. It is not known whether this medicine will harm an unborn baby. Tell your doctor if you are pregnant, plan to become pregnant, or are breastfeeding. ..

Effective Management of CKD-Related Anemia

Mircera Injection is specifically formulated to address anemia in patients suffering from chronic kidney disease. By enhancing red blood cell production, it alleviates symptoms like fatigue and weakness, improving overall patient well-being. Designed for convenience, it requires administration only once every 2 to 4 weeks under a healthcare provider's guidance. Mircera's efficacy and safety profile make it suitable for both adult and pediatric patients, following a tailored medical approach.


Usage Instructions and Administration

Mircera is administered as a subcutaneous or intravenous injection, depending on physician recommendation. Dosage and scheduling-typically every two to four weeks-are determined by your healthcare provider based on your specific clinical needs. It is usually given by a trained professional in a clinical or hospital setting to ensure correct and safe administration.


Storage and Handling Guidelines

Preserve Mircera in its original packaging, refrigerated at 2C to 8C, and avoid freezing. Ensure it remains out of children's reach and never use the injection past its expiration date. Before administration, always check that the solution appears clear and is free of particles, as proper storage helps maintain its effectiveness.

FAQ's of Mircera 50mcg Injection:


Q: How does Mircera 50mcg Injection benefit patients with chronic kidney disease?

A: Mircera stimulates the production of red blood cells by mimicking natural erythropoietin, effectively managing anemia related to chronic kidney disease. It helps restore healthy hemoglobin levels, alleviating symptoms such as fatigue and improving quality of life.

Q: What is the process for administering Mircera 50mcg Injection?

A: Mircera is injected either subcutaneously or intravenously by a healthcare professional in a hospital or clinical environment. The exact method and frequency-usually every two to four weeks-are determined by your treating physician.

Q: When should Mircera 50mcg Injection not be used?

A: Mircera should not be used in patients with uncontrolled hypertension or known hypersensitivity to Methoxy Polyethylene Glycol-Epoetin Beta or any of the excipients in the formulation.

Q: Where should I store Mircera 50mcg Injection at home if not administered immediately?

A: Store Mircera in a refrigerator at 2C to 8C in its original packaging. Do not freeze, and always keep the product out of reach of children. Do not use it if it has expired or if the solution looks cloudy or contains particles.

Q: What precautions are necessary during Mircera therapy?

A: Regular monitoring of hemoglobin levels is essential during Mircera treatment. Patients with cardiovascular disorders require special caution due to potential risks. Always follow the dosage and monitoring instructions provided by your healthcare provider.

Q: Who can receive Mircera 50mcg Injection?

A: Mircera is suitable for adults and children with anemia due to chronic kidney disease, including those on dialysis or not on dialysis, as prescribed by a doctor. The use and dosage for pediatric patients should always be directed by a specialist.

Q: How frequently is Mircera typically administered?

A: Mircera is commonly given once every two to four weeks, depending on your clinical response and your doctor's advice. Dosage schedules are individualized based on ongoing medical assessments.
